What is the purpose of a brake and head lamp inspection?

In California, an inspection of the brakes and lamps is necessary to ensure that a vehicle is safe to drive and operates properly. Brake and lamp inspections are required each time the title of a car is changed, which includes after a car accident or vehicle theft. The DMV requires a thorough examination by a State Licensed Inspection Station to ensure that no part of the brake system or vehicle’s lights is damaged or misaligned due to an accident or theft. The general objective of these inspections is the safety of the driver and the safety of other drivers on the road!

Brake inspection

What happens during a brake inspection?

When Best Auto Service performs an official brake inspection, we follow the rules and regulations established by the State of California. We remove the tires from your car and perform a thorough visual inspection, in addition to using special measuring devices to ensure that all the manufacturer’s specifications are met. We make sure there are no risks that make the brake system malfunction. Lamp Inspection

What happens during a head lamp inspection?

Our brake and lamp technicians are authorized by the California Bureau of Automotive Repair Office (B.A.R.). We only use B.A.R. approved equipment and procedures when we perform our official lamp inspections. During these lamp inspections, we verify that your car’s lighting system works properly. We visually inspect the lighting system of your vehicle and measure the objective of your headlights. We also make sure that your brake lights, turn signals and safety lights are in perfect working order. Once we complete the inspection, we will issue a 90-day certificate that can be submitted to the California DMV as proof that your vehicle has already passed and is ready to go.
